Web25 jan. 2024 · Humidity lowers the density of air (so much for humid air feeling heavy!), which makes it travel slightly faster. Heat makes air molecules move around faster, so they’re more ready to carry a pressure wave than slower-moving molecules. Because of that, heat makes sound travel faster, too. Do sound waves travel faster in dry air? WebSound travels fastest through solids. Indeed, the molecules of a solid medium are much closer to each other than those of a liquid or a gas, which allows sound waves to pass through it more quickly. In fact, sound waves travel 17 times faster in steel than in air. What are the 3 types of sound?

WebThis explains why sound travels faster through hotter air compared to colder air. The speed of sound at 20 degrees Celsius is about 343 meters per second, but the speed of sound at zero degrees Celsius is only about 331 meters per second.
